The Shifting Sands of Fashion: A Broader Context
The rise and fall, and potential resurgence, of the slide sandal can be viewed within the broader context of fashion trends. Historically, the slide sandal, particularly iconic models like the Adidas Adilette, emerged as a practical and comfortable footwear option, often associated with athletic activities and casual leisure. Its simplicity and ease of wear made it a global phenomenon.
However, as fashion evolved, a desire for more elaborate and structured footwear took hold. Platforms, stilettos, and intricately designed sandals dominated runways and street style. The slide, with its unadorned design, began to be perceived as too casual, too basic, or even passé. This perception was amplified as designers and brands introduced more fashion-forward alternatives like embellished slides, architectural mules, and minimalist thong sandals.

The current fashion cycle, however, shows a distinct leaning towards comfort and understated luxury. The "quiet luxury" movement, which prioritizes high-quality materials and timeless designs over overt branding, has paved the way for a renewed appreciation of simpler silhouettes. The pandemic further accelerated this shift, normalizing comfortable and practical footwear for everyday occasions. This cultural backdrop makes Lawrence’s embrace of the slide sandal not just a personal style choice but a potential harbinger of a wider trend.
Data-Driven Insights into Footwear Preferences
While specific sales data for slide sandals in recent months is not publicly available, broader market trends offer supporting context. The global footwear market has seen significant growth, with a notable increase in the casual and athleisure segments. Reports from market research firms often highlight the enduring popularity of comfortable and versatile footwear. For instance, a 2023 report by Grand View Research projected the global footwear market to reach $592.1 billion by 2030, driven by factors including the increasing adoption of athleisure wear and a growing emphasis on comfort.
The resurgence of certain vintage styles, often referred to as "Y2K fashion" or "throwback trends," also plays a role. The early 2000s were a heyday for slide sandals, and their reintroduction into the contemporary fashion lexicon can be seen as part of this larger nostalgic wave. This phenomenon is not unique to footwear; it extends to clothing, accessories, and even beauty trends, reflecting a generational fascination with past aesthetics.
